Determine whether each of the following oxides is acidic, basic, or amphoteric. Use balanced chemical equations to support your answer.
(A) MgO (B) SO3 (C) Ga2O3 (D) Na2O (E) H2O (F) P4O10
Solution
Basic oxides will produce hydroxide ions when treated with water.
Acidic oxides will produce Hydrogen ions when treated with water.
(A) Basic oxide
MgO (s) + H2O (l) ----------> Mg(OH)2 (aq.) Magnesium hydroxide
(B) Acidic oxide
SO3 (g) + H2O (l) --------------> H2SO4 (aq.) Sulphuric acid
(C) Basic oxide
Ga2O3 (s) + 3 H2O (l) -----------> 2 Ga(OH)3 (aq.) Gallium hydroxide
(D) Basic oxide
Na2O (s) + H2O (l) -----------> 2 NaOH (aq.) SOdium hydroxide
(E) When it is alone, acts as neutral.
But it acts as base when treated with acids and acid when treated with bases. Henc it is amphoteric.
(F) Acidic oxide
P4O10 (s) + 6 H2O (l) -----------> 4 H3PO4 (aq.) Phosphoric acid
